When buying an electric shaver, it’s easy to get torn between choosing a rotary shaver and a foil shaver. Both types of electric shavers can provide a relatively close shave when used with the right technique. However, the way they cut hair is what makes them different, and may lead to a closer shave in one type. It’s hard to say that there’s an outright winner between the two types as some men swear by rotary shavers while others are staunch devotees of foil shavers.
However, if you’re like the majority of men who have no side, learning the difference between the two shaving technologies will help you assess your needs based on those differences.
How They Work
Rotary Shaver – This type of shaver comprises of a series of circular cutters attached to round blades, usually three blades. The blades are typically arranged in a triangular pattern and they simply spin As the name suggests, a rotary shaver is used in slow, rotating motions, almost as if you were massaging the skin with a cream.
A rotary shaver is normally ideal for longer hair. If you don’t shave frequently, a rotary shaver is what you need, for instance, those men that don’t shave for the whole weekend and want to start Monday with a clean shave.
Foil Shaver – This type of shaver comprises a series of several blades covered by a thin metallic layer. It’s usually gentler to sensitive skin. The slots on the foil capture hair which is then cut close to the skin. Thus, this type of shaver typically offers a closer shave than the rotary type. A foil shaver is also better at trimming a defined finish such as side burns. They are better at cutting shorter hair.
Which Type Should You Choose?
Although foil shavers generally give a closer shave, it doesn’t make them outright winners. Each type of shaver can be used effectively if you know how. If you don’t know which type to choose, here are a few pointers:
Choose rotary if:
- You have thick hair
- Your hair grows wildly
- Your hair grows in several directions
- You don’t want to be cleaning your shaver so often.
- You don’t want a shave that is so close
Choose the foil type if:
- You shave frequently (like daily)
- Your hair grows in a straight line
- Need a close shave
- Require more precision
- Frequently clean your shaver
